2018 Toyota Auris Manual

Product Description

The 2018 Toyota Auris is a highly practical and reliable compact car. It is celebrated for its excellent fuel efficiency—especially the hybrid model—smooth urban driving dynamics, and comfortable cabin. It comes in both hatchback and Touring Sports (wagon) body styles.

Key Specifications

Engine Options: Available as a 1.2L turbocharged petrol, 1.3L petrol, 1.4L diesel, and the popular 1.8L self-charging hybrid.
Transmission: 6-speed manual or CVT (Continuously Variable Transmission).
Fuel Economy: The 1.8L hybrid achieves up to 68.8 mpg (approx. 4.1 L/100km) combined, making it ideal for low running costs.
Dimensions (Hatchback): Length: 4,331 mm | Width: 1,760 mm | Height: 1,476 mm.

Features & Technology

Trims: Options include Icon, Design, and Excel, with higher trims featuring features like Alcantara or heated leather seats, LED headlights, and Intelligent Park Assist.
Safety: Equipped with the Toyota Safety Sense system, which includes driver-assist technology.
Multimedia: Features the Toyota Touch 2 system with a 7-inch touchscreen, Bluetooth, and reversing camera.

Practicality & Reliability

Boot Space: The hatchback offers 360 liters of cargo space, while the Touring Sports estate extends up to 1,635 liters with the rear seats folded.

Reliability: The Auris is broadly known for its durability, though common second-hand issues are usually minor, such as failure of the separate 12V auxiliary battery.
